B and Z Charters LLC is a charter-boat operator in Orange Beach, giving visitors a straightforward way to get out on the water along Alabama’s Gulf Coast. It appeals to travelers looking for a private or small-group boating experience rather than a crowded tour, with the main draw being time on the water, coastal scenery, and the chance to enjoy the area from a local captain’s perspective. For visitors to Orange Beach, it’s a practical option for fishing, cruising, or simply experiencing the Gulf in a more personal way.
Expert notes
- Confirm departure location and parking instructions before arrival.
- Check whether the charter provides gear, bait, and ice or whether you need to bring your own.
- Be prepared for weather-related schedule changes, which are common for Gulf Coast boating trips.
